Transaction f31700017890f2d2d35b47fc83cd7e499abbe9d9f91cb3b29283294191e7295a

34 Input
1 Outputs
  • f31700017890f2d2d35b47fc83cd7e499abbe9d9f91cb3b29283294191e7295a:0
  • value  4194573272
    address  3JwiC7JvpGGCztvEzH3X1hqhyLHKDr3bLE